Description


This image shows the initial results of a technique that I recently discovered and am currently developing to create glows, softer edges and a rapidly growing list of potential new effects. The effect occurs entirely within Poser4 without the use of texture maps or plug-ins. I made the discovery while tech editing and creating an image for the soon to be released "Poser4 ProPack FX & Design" book being written by Richard Schrand for The Coriolis Group. The glow effect is due to premiere in the publication and should be a fun and exciting effect to use.
